Doria is a Japanese western-style rice casserole dish with a creamy white sauce. It looks very similar to baked Gratin.

My Secret Rice Gratin (Doria) step by step

  1. Put butter in a pan and cook the chicken (cut into bite-sized pieces), onion, and other vegetables (whatever vegetables you like). Sprinkle in the flour and continue to cook, but be sure not to let it burn. Slowly stir in the milk, mixing thoroughly..
  2. When the mixture has thickened into a firm mass, season with salt and pepper. Add in the rice and quickly mix..
  3. Divide the mixture into two gratin dishes. Squirt mayonnaise, tomatoes (cut up first), cheese, and panko. In a toaster oven or oven, heat the dish through until the cheese is well melted and a golden brown crust has formed..
